What Does an Accident Attorney Do?

An experienced accident lawyer can assist you in the process of recovering compensation. They will consider the most likely cause of your injuries, examine medical documents and calculate current and future damages, such as lost wages and costs for treatment.

Insurance companies will often challenge your claim or minimize the extent of your injuries to avoid paying you the right amount. You need an attorney who specializes in car accidents to fight on your behalf.

Gather Evidence

In many car accident and injury attorneys cases, it is important to be aware of the details and know where to look. One of the most important tasks an attorney does is gather evidence to support their client's claims and help to build a strong case. This involves a wide range of tasks, including examining medical records, obtaining eyewitness evidence, and enlisting experts in the form of police reconstruction experts and medical experts.

One of the first things an attorney representing victims of accidents is to visit the site of the accident and examine it physically. They will take photographs or videos to capture any visible damages or unsafe conditions and the position of the vehicle at the time of the accident and injury attorneys. They will also gather evidence to show that there were some underlying issues that caused the accident. For instance, if a roadway was not adequately lit or had a bumpy surface, it may have contributed to the accident.

They can also interview witnesses who can offer crucial information regarding the cause of the accident and injury lawyers. They will be able to explain how the crash occurred, describe any physical injuries, and offer an account of the events leading to the crash. Additionally, they can consult with medical experts who can give professional advice on the extent of your injuries and their lasting impact on your life.

The official police report will also be used by an attorney. They will review it and analyze its contents to determine if the accident could have been avoided. They will also review insurance policies to determine if the insurance coverage is sufficient to cover any potential damages. They will also establish a connection between the actions of the defendant and your injuries to demonstrate the proximate cause, which is an essential component in a successful lawsuit for damages.

The next step is to estimate the victim's non-economic and economic damages. Non-economic damages are emotional distress and loss in enjoyment of life. Economic damages are medical costs and lost income. A lawyer who is specialized in accident law will make use of the evidence available to determine the amount of damages. They will then collaborate with their client to determine a fair amount of compensation.

They negotiate a settlement

Once a claim has been submitted, your attorney will meet with the insurance claims adjuster to reach the settlement. Insurance companies can be a challenge to deal with, and often stall the process by asking for unnecessary documents or documents. An experienced lawyer is aware of the tactics these companies use and can anticipate these tactics, making sure that you are not taken advantage of.

Your attorney will consider all the ways in which your accident has affected your life when negotiations. This includes your present and future medical expenses, the cost of any property damage, lost income due to a loss of work, as well as your pain and suffering. They will also take into consideration any existing injury that was worsened as a result of the accident.

In constructing the case for damages your attorney will also talk with experts witnesses. These professionals can provide key information that will support your claim including medical treatment plans and prognoses. They can also provide accident scene evaluations, as well as damage assessments. Your lawyer will make sure that these experts have a good track record in their field and have experience in delivering this type of testimony.

Your attorney will establish a minimum settlement amount after a thorough assessment of your losses. Insurance companies are likely to respond with a lower settlement offer. This is a tactic used in negotiations to test your patience, and determine if you are willing to settle for less than you deserve. Your attorney will review the offer made by the adjuster from insurance with you and offer guidance on how to proceed.

Negotiations can take long time. Your attorney accident lawyer (browse around this site) will keep you informed about the process progresses and ensure that all deadlines are adhered to. They will be your advocate throughout the process and will do their best to negotiate an equitable settlement.

If a reasonable settlement can't be reached, your lawyer will prepare for trial. This could mean filing a lawsuit, which will be a formalization of legal theories and allegations, and damages data. It could force insurers to settle as they will be forced to pay legal costs and could be liable to an appeal to a jury. A seasoned accident lawyer will understand relevant court procedures and employ successful legal strategies to ensure you receive a satisfactory settlement.
